Mental Health in Davenport, OK - What is Mental Health
Mental health is defined as the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ral state. Simply put: It’s our mental state. It can affect everything from how we think and feel, to our actions and stimulus responses.
Our mental health can have a major impact on our overall quality of life, affecting day-to-day interactions and relationships at work, at home, and in our love lives. It impacts our self-esteem, changes how we make choices, our ability to communicate, and even how we learn.
Even though we cannot physically see or measure it, our mental well-being directly relates to how we interact with the rest of the world. How our minds operate, ultimately determined who we are as individuals.
Types of Mental Health Providers in Davenport, OK
A mental health disorder can manifest itself in a number of ways, (negative or irrational thoughts, physical ailments, problematic behaviors) and the intensity can range from mild to severe. As such, there are multiple types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in Davenport
Psychologists are trained and educated to conduct psychological evaluations and provide diagnoses. They’re skilled in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. Much of their practice zeros in on addressing and resolving dest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in Davenport
Sometimes an individual needs more immediate or intense treatment than what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Although they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Davenport
All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als with a masters-level education in in a field related to mental or public health. As they are not physicians, they address m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. Individual and group therapy is their technique of choice to resolve issues.
